Valspar

Kilimanjaro

T646

Kilimanjaro is a pale mineral gray, softly green and quiet. It stays quiet on walls. Use it when a room needs a cooler neutral that still has a natural cast, especially in baths, bedrooms, or entryways with stone flooring.

White trim will reveal the green. Warm wood cuts the clinical edge. In dim corners, it may flatten toward a pale gray.

Kilimanjaro in Different Light

Light temperature is measured in Kelvin: a warm 2700K bulb pulls colors toward yellow, while 5000K daylight reads cooler and truer. Check the color at the time of day you actually use the room.

LRV measures how much light a color reflects, from 0 (black) to 100 (pure white). Below about 50 a color needs good lighting to avoid going flat, 60 and up helps brighten a room, and most whites sit above 80.
